Description

Carton stacking equipment
Technical Field
The utility model relates to a carton technical field especially relates to a carton stack equipment.
Background
The paper box is the most widely used packing product, and has various specifications and models, such as corrugated paper boxes, single-layer cardboard boxes and the like according to different materials. The carton is commonly used for three layers and five layers, seven layers are used less, each layer is divided into lining paper, corrugated paper, core paper and face paper, the lining paper and the face paper comprise tea board paper and kraft paper, the corrugated paper for the core paper has different colors and handfeel, and the paper produced by different manufacturers is different. When the discarded paper boxes are stored, the paper boxes are usually pressed into plates and then stacked in order to save space, but the existing paper box stacking equipment is inconvenient to use, and therefore a paper box stacking equipment is provided.
SUMMERY OF THE UTILITY MODEL
The utility model aims at solving the shortcoming of inconvenient use in the prior art and providing a carton stacking device.
In order to achieve the above purpose, the utility model adopts the following technical scheme:
a carton stacking device is designed, comprising a bottom plate, wherein supporting legs are fixed at four corners of the bottom plate, wheels are fixed at the bottoms of the supporting legs, a vertical plate is fixed at one side above the bottom plate, a sliding groove is formed in one side of the vertical plate, a sliding block is arranged in the sliding groove in a sliding manner, bearings are fixed on two side walls of the sliding groove, one bearing is connected with a threaded rod, one end of the threaded rod penetrates through the sliding block and the other bearing and is connected with a rotating mechanism between the threaded rod and the bottom plate, the threaded rod is connected with the sliding block through threads, a supporting plate is fixed at one side of the sliding block, a side plate is fixed at one side above the supporting plate, a baffle is arranged on the supporting plate at one side of the side plate, an electric telescopic rod is fixed, both sides below the baffle are fixed with upper sliding blocks, and the upper sliding blocks are arranged in the upper sliding grooves in a sliding mode.
Preferably, a push rod is fixed on one side above the bottom plate, and push handles are fixed on two sides of one end of the push rod.
Preferably, the supporting plate is fixed with connecting plates on two sides, the bottom plates on two sides of the vertical plate are fixed with sliding rods, and one ends of the sliding rods penetrate through the connecting plates and extend upwards.
Preferably, support rods are fixed between two sides of the vertical plate and the bottom plate.
Preferably, slewing mechanism includes frid and support, the frid is fixed in threaded rod one end, the support is fixed in the bottom plate, install the motor on the support, be connected with the pivot on the motor, pivot one end is fixed with the rectangle inserted block, and the rectangle inserted block inserts and establish at the frid.
The utility model provides a pair of carton stacking equipment, beneficial effect lies in: this carton stacking equipment can be convenient for the device through the wheel and remove, place in the backup pad through the carton board that will carry out the stack, can drive the threaded rod through slewing mechanism and rotate, the threaded rod rotates and just can drive the slider and remove in the spout to this can drive backup pad rebound, when removing to suitable position, rethread control electric telescopic handle drives the baffle and removes, so that can push off the carton board in the backup pad to buttress and pile up the heap.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Example 1
Referring to fig. 1-2, a carton stacking device comprises a bottom plate 1, a push rod 4 is fixed on one side above the bottom plate 1, push handles 5 are fixed on two sides of one end of the push rod 4, support legs 2 are fixed on four corners of the bottom plate 1, wheels 3 are fixed on the bottoms of the support legs 2, a vertical plate 6 is fixed on one side above the bottom plate 1, support rods 19 are fixed between two sides of the vertical plate 6 and the bottom plate 1, a chute 7 is formed in one side of the vertical plate 6, a slide block 9 is arranged in the chute 7 in a sliding mode, bearings 8 are fixed on two side walls of the chute 7, one of the bearings 8 is connected with a threaded rod 10, one end of the threaded rod 10 penetrates through the slide block 9 and the other bearing 8 and is connected with a rotating mechanism between the bottom plate 1, the threaded rod 10 and the slide block 9 are connected through threads, a support plate 11 is fixed, can drive threaded rod 10 through slewing mechanism and rotate, threaded rod 10 rotates just can drive slider 9 and remove in spout 7 to this can drive backup pad 11 rebound.
11 top one sides of backup pad are fixed with curb plate 12, be provided with baffle 14 in the backup pad 11 of curb plate 12 one side, 12 one sides of curb plate are fixed with electric telescopic handle 13, electric telescopic handle 13 one end is fixed in backup pad 11, spout 15 has all been seted up in the backup pad 11 of 11 below both sides of backup pad, 14 below both sides of baffle all are fixed with slider 16, and slider 16 slides and sets up in last spout 15, when backup pad 11 removes to suitable position, rethread control electric telescopic handle 13 drives baffle 14 and removes, so that can push off the carton board in backup pad 11 to piling up the heap.
Example 2
Referring to fig. 1-2, as another preferred embodiment of the present invention, the difference from embodiment 1 is that the supporting plate 11 is fixed with connecting plates 18 on both sides, the bottom plate 1 on both sides of the riser 6 is fixed with sliding rods 17, and one end of the sliding rod 17 passes through the connecting plate 18 and extends upward, and the sliding rod 17 passes through the connecting plate 18 to limit both sides of the supporting plate 11.
Example 3
Referring to fig. 1-3, as another preferred embodiment of the present invention, the difference from embodiment 1 lies in that, the rotating mechanism includes a groove plate 24 and a bracket 20, the groove plate 24 is fixed at one end of the threaded rod 10, the bracket 20 is fixed at the bottom of the bottom plate 1, the bracket 20 is provided with a motor 21, the motor 21 is connected with a rotating shaft 22, one end of the rotating shaft 22 is fixed with a rectangular insert 23, the rectangular insert 23 is inserted into the groove plate 24, the motor 21 can drive the rotating shaft 22 to rotate by starting the motor 21, and the rotating shaft 22 rotates and is inserted into the groove plate 24 through the rectangular insert 23 to drive the threaded rod 10 to rotate.
